Driveway Pavers Replacement in Ogden, UT
Driveway pavers replacement involves removing and replacing existing driveway surfaces to restore or improve their appearance and functionality. This service typically covers projects where the current driveway is cracked, uneven, or showing signs of wear, and property owners are seeking a fresh, durable surface. Common materials used include concrete, asphalt, brick, or stone pavers, allowing for customization based on aesthetic preferences and usage needs. Homeowners interested in this service should consider the condition of their current driveway, the desired materials, and any specific design features they want to incorporate.
Before requesting driveway pavers replacement, property owners often want to understand the scope of work, including the removal process, surface preparation, and installation procedures. It’s also helpful to consider factors such as drainage, driveway size, and local climate conditions that could affect material choice and longevity.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, attractive driveway that complements the property’s overall appearance.

Driveway Pavers Replacement Questions
When should driveway pavers be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the existing surface shows extensive cracking, uneven settling, or significant deterioration that affects safety and appearance.
What types of driveway materials are available for replacement? Common options include concrete, brick, and stone pavers, each offering different styles and durability levels suited for residential properties.
How can I tell if my driveway needs replacement instead of repair? Signs include persistent cracking, large potholes, or uneven surfaces that cannot be fixed effectively with patching or resurfacing.
What are typical reasons for driveway paver replacement? Replacement may be needed due to age, severe weather damage, shifting ground, or to update the look of a property.
